CASA Seminar
Preservation of high-brightness electron beams during acceleration and compression in linear accelerators is important for free electron lasers. In this talk, I will review the theoretical understanding of a microbunching instability driven by longitudinal space charge in linacs and coherent synchrotron radiation in magnetic bunch compressors. I will show numerical results and experimental evidences how the instability may affect the beam quality for various FEL projects. I will also discuss an effective beam heater designed for the Linac Coherent Light Source to suppress the instability without degrading the FEL performance.
